So, 'The Underwater Realm - Part III - 1588' is an interesting piece in the series with its unique take on the Spanish Armada. The atmosphere is thick with tension; the sound of crashing waves and cannon fire pulls you into that chaotic historical moment. You’ve got this young boy, just trying to survive, and when he gets thrown into the depths, the film dives into some haunting visuals - it's almost poetic, really, how they depict the sinking ships and drowning men. The practical effects lend a certain rawness that really sets it apart, though there's this underlying sadness that makes you ponder the futility of war. It’s not everyone's cup of tea, but there’s a certain charm in its execution that lasts.
